Rams WR Puka Nacua, who left practice while walking with a trainer, is dealing with minor soreness in his groin, I'm told. The team is just being cautious.

NBA Christmas Day 2026 on ABC and ESPN: - Spurs @ Knicks - Heat @ Celtics - 76ers @ Lakers - Thunder @ Timberwolves - Nuggets @ Warriors
